What is the signing under power of attorney
The signing under power of attorney is a legal document that allows one person to act on behalf of another in legal or financial matters. This document grants authority to the designated individual, known as the attorney-in-fact or agent, to make decisions and sign documents for the principal, who is the person granting the power. It is commonly used in situations where the principal is unable to manage their affairs due to illness, absence, or other reasons.

Legal use of the signing under power of attorney
The legal use of the signing under power of attorney varies by state, but generally, it is recognized as a valid means of delegating authority. It is essential to ensure that the document complies with state laws, including any requirements for witnesses or notarization. The agent must act in the best interests of the principal and adhere to the powers granted in the document.
Key elements of the signing under power of attorney
Key elements of the signing under power of attorney include:
- The names and contact information of the principal and agent.
- A clear description of the powers being granted.
- The effective date of the document and any conditions for its use.
- Signatures of the principal and any required witnesses or notaries.
